Road cycling around Nuenen, Gerwen En Nederwetten offers a landscape characterized by lush greenery, tranquil waterways, and varied terrain. The region features expansive heathlands, such as the Strabrechtse Heide, alongside numerous forests and green spaces. The river Dommel meanders through the area, with many paths following its course. Overall elevation changes are generally low, making routes accessible for various fitness levels.

Gemert Castle is one of the village's most striking historical buildings. The complex dates back to the 13th century and was owned for centuries by the Teutonic Order, which had its commandery here. Because of this long history, you'll find a mix of architectural styles on the grounds: medieval elements, an impressive gateway, later residential wings, and a moat that encircles the entire complex. The castle itself is not freely accessible, but from the road and surrounding paths, you have a beautiful view of the walls, towers, and gatehouse. The surrounding area is charming, with old tree-lined avenues, water features, and historic outbuildings that complete the setting. It's a pleasant place for walkers to stop and take a photo or soak up the tranquil atmosphere around the moat.

The Genneper Watermill is one of the oldest and most characteristic mills in Eindhoven. The mill was mentioned as early as 1249 and stands along the Dommel River in the green Genneper Parken. After being destroyed during the Eighty Years' War, it was rebuilt in 1587. For centuries, grain was ground here, oil was pressed, and wool was felted. The mill is best known because Vincent van Gogh painted it several times during his stay in Nuenen. Today, the mill still operates with a single waterwheel and is a national monument. On certain days, you can visit the inside and buy organic flour in the small mill shop. A historic and photogenic spot surrounded by nature, the perfect resting place during a walk through the Genneper Parken.

There are 10 dedicated no-traffic road cycling routes in Nuenen, Gerwen En Nederwetten, perfect for enjoying the region's landscapes without vehicle interference. These routes range from easy to moderate difficulty, ensuring options for various fitness levels.
The region offers diverse and appealing landscapes. You'll find routes winding through lush greenery, tranquil waterways like the river Dommel, and scenic forests. While primarily well-paved for road bikes, some areas, particularly around heathlands like the Strabrechtse Heide, might feature sections where you'll encounter natural paths, though the focus for these routes is on smooth, traffic-free surfaces. The overall elevation changes are generally low, making for accessible rides.
